2006 has been a great year for AA. Our member base has increased and our free records topped 1,000,000. The site went from strength to strength and I for one am very proud of what ALL of us have achieved. Members, staff and owners alike. So a big thank you for your support.
We had the paid site at the beginning of the year but hated the fact that we were going against the whole reason behind AA, and that was to have a completely free genealogy community when we could give as much as we could to our members without them having to pay a penny. Thus we binned the paid site and returned to our roots of being free.
The year marched on and we have grown into a decent, friendly community that, I for one have noticed, are only to pleased to help each other. The comments we get from new (and old) members refering to how friendly this site is, is testement to how you all make this the friendliest genealogy site on the net. Again, thank you!!

So whats instore for 2007?
2007 will prove to be another great year for AA. The only downside to this is that, because I have to go away for a few months soon, you wont see the changes until the second half of the year, but I'm sure the wait will be worth it.
We plan to have the Free Records Project up and running, improvements to the current facilities on the site, extra features will also be added but more info on that later and AA WILL undergo another face lift nearer the end of the year.

Thank you all for all your hard work over the last 12 months since we relaunched AA back in January. You have all (members and staff) made us, the owners of AA, very proud that we started this great site. Heres looking forward to an even better 2007 !!!
